Eight detained in anti-KCK operation in Şemdinli
Source: Todayszaman Turkish police detained eight people in an operation carried out against the Kurdish Communities Union (KCK), an umbrella political organization that includes the Kurdistan Workers' Party (PKK) terrorist organization, in the Şemdinli district of the southeastern province of Hakkari on Friday. | |
The state-run Anatolia news agency said
simultaneous raids were carried out by counterterrorism units in a
number of premises in Şemdinli and Altunsu village early Friday. Eight
people, including a Şemdinli municipality official and an official from
the pro-Kurdish Peace and Democracy Party's (BDP) local branch in
Şemdinli, were reportedly detained during the raids. The KCK investigation started in December 2009 and a large number of Kurdish politicians, including several mayors from the BDP, have been detained in the case. There are a total of 152 suspects in the ongoing KCK trial. They stand accused of various crimes, including membership in a terrorist organization, aiding and abetting a terrorist organization and attempting to destroy the country's unity and integrity. The suspects include 12 mayors from the pro-Kurdish BDP. |
